Photovoltaic (PV) Solar Panels: The primary type of solar energy technology being adopted in Pakistan due to low price and ease of installation. In 2025, Pakistan had 689 certified PV installers who completed approximately 143,222 solar PV system installations from July to February of that year.
The country now has seven large-scale solar projects that contribute 530 MW to the national grid, along with a growing number of harder to measure off-grid projects. The country has solar plants in Pakistani Kashmir, Punjab, Sindh and Balochistan.
The country has solar plants in Pakistani Kashmir, Punjab, Sindh and Balochistan. Initiatives are under development by the International Renewable Energy Agency, the Japan International Cooperation Agency, Chinese companies, and Pakistani private sector energy companies.

Pakistan has emerged as one of the world's fastest-growing solar markets, importing around 50 GW of panels amid falling prices and widespread adoption across sectors — but comprehensive data on actual installations remains limited. . Pakistan has grown its solar energy capacity by an astounding amount in a remarkably short space of time. The shock surge has given residents the power to survive blackouts, but it threatens to disrupt the grid. In just a few years, the country's electric grid transformed from negligible solar power to an expected 20% of all its electricity. . But by the end of 2024, it quietly rocketed into the top tier of solar adopters, importing a jaw-dropping 22 gigawatts worth of solar panels in a single year. With an estimated capacity between 1 GW and 1. 7 GW, stand-alone solar home systems are now the most common off-grid electricity source, enabling households in poor and remote areas to access daytime electricity for their basic needs — a service that was until now unavailable to them. .
